Boundary conditions for translation-invariant Gibbs measures of the Potts model on Cayley trees

Published 6 Apr 2015 in math-ph and math.MP | (1504.01265v2)

Abstract: We consider translation-invariant splitting Gibbs measures (TISGMs) for the $q$-state Potts model on a Cayley tree of order two. Recently a full description of the TISGMs was obtained, and it was shown in particular that at sufficiently low temperatures their number is $2{q}-1$. In this paper for each TISGM $\mu$ we explicitly give the set of boundary conditions such that limiting Gibbs measures with respect to these boundary conditions coincide with $\mu$.
